You will probably have to remove hairs before the operation; ask your surgeon what method is best. Usually, waxing is the best solution, but you might be able to shave if you do not have a lot of hairs. Your surgeon should be able to recommend the better method and the best products.

Do not hesitate to find out about your cosmetic surgeon's insurance coverage for malpractice. If a mistake is made, you want to be able to receive compensation so that you can have the error fixed. Don't use a surgeon who doesn't have proper insurance. It's not only illegal for doctors not to carry malpractice insurance, but doctors who don't may be subject to high premiums because of past problems.

Learn of what preparations you will need to take for surgery after-care. Certain cosmetic surgeries, such as breast augmentation, require you to take medications, or creams after you have the procedure. It is wise to learn about after-care before surgery. The last thing you want to have to do after the procedure, is run out to get the products.

Be aware that the total cost of your surgery may change. Many things come into play that could change the costs, like anesthesia costs, multi-location surgeries and other fees. When you have a consultation, talk to the doctor about all the costs involved. Do not pay any amount until you know the full extent of the money necessary.

Dr Debraj Shome, a well-known facial plastic surgeon says that many people come with very unrealistic expectations and think that plastic surgeons are gods who can make them look their idol, the common one being Angelina Jolie. He says that all we can do is make you a better version of yourself and work on your flaws.
One of the main reasons why these surgeries go wrong horribly is because people go for it without making an informed choice. It is also a result of poor advice and low awareness. It is vital that one chooses the right doctor. “Assess them before you go under the knife, don’t just jump into it as there are many quacks out there who just want to mint money,” he says.

Even if you are in the best of hands, there are slight chances that things can go wrong which may not be in the surgeon’s control. The common mindset people have is – nothing can go wrong with me, these things happen just to others. “It has to be an informed choice taken by you after considering the pros and cons carefully, given that it is your body and your life! So, do not blame the ‘doctor’ or the procedure, instead choose the right doctor and the right procedure for you – make an informed choice,” he advises.
